FLORIDA FUNERAL LAWS & RULES FINAL EXAM 180

QUESTIONS & DETAILED ANSWERS ALREADY GRADED

A+ NEW

Order of priority of a "Legally Authorized Person" - CORRECT ANSWER >>> - The

Decedent

  • Person designated by decedent
  • Surviving spouse
  • Son or daughter 18+
  • A parent
  • Brother or sister 18+
  • Grandchild 18+
  • A grandparent
  • Any person in the next degree of kinship

If there is no family member existing or available, the legally authorized person may include: -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> - Guardian at the time of death

  • Personal representative
  • Attorney-in-fact at the time of death
  • Health surrogate
  • Public health officer
  • Medical examiner
  • County commission or administrator
  • Nursing home representative
  • Friend

A funeral establishment need only rely upon one person from an authorized class, if that person

represents that: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> she/he is not aware of any objection to the

cremation of the deceased, by others in the same class or a higher priority class. There are 10 members on the Board of Funeral, Cemetery and Consumer Services. The

composition of the Board is: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> - 2 funeral directors

  • 1 funeral director who sells pre-need and has a crematory
  • 2 cemeterians
  • 3 public members not associated with funeral service.
  • 1 monument dealer
  • the State Health Officer Two of the three public members on the Board of Funeral, Cemetery and Consumer Services

must include: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> - A member over 60 years old

  • A member who is a CPA.

There shall NOT be two or more board members who are: -^ CORRECT ANSWER

>>> Principals or employees of the same company or partnership

Each board member shall serve a term of ____ - CORRECT ANSWER >>> 4 years

In a case of malfeasance, incompetence, etc;

the ____ may remove a board member -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Senate

May a natural person apply for a cemetery license?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> No (only a

corporation, partnership, or LLC)

Are licenses transferable if the business sells to another owner? -^ CORRECT ANSWER

>>> No

When applying for any of the establishment licenses, the application must include a listing of: -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> Everyone who controls more than 10% of the company.

Can a hospital or nursing home operate a direct disposal establishment? - CORRECT

ANSWER >>> No

If a license applicant is convicted of any crimes within the past 10 years, he/she must provide: -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> Certified copies of court records of the crime

What convictions must be disclosed to the board during application for licensure? -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> - Any felony or misdemeanor relating to this chapter no matter when

committed.

  • Any other felony committed within the past 20 years
  • Any other misdemeanor committed within the past 5 years.

What types of crimes do not have to be reported to the board at the time of application? -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> Speeding tickets or other noncriminal traffic infractions

Who may apply for a limited license?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> A retired Florida licensee or

someone holds an active license to practice in another jurisdiction of the United States

May a person with a limited license engage in preneed sales? -^ CORRECT ANSWER

>>> No

When can a limited licensee provide services?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> In times of critical

need

If you have an address change, how long do you have to notify the Board? - CORRECT

ANSWER >>> 30 days

How many days does the funeral home have to record the written complaint in the complaint

log?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Within 10 days

What is the composition of a probable cause panel?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> At least 2

people, one of which must be a consumer member

When must the educational requirement be completed for operational personnel? -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> Within 30 days of being hired

What is the maximum educational requirement for operational personnel Health and Safety

training?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> 3 hours

When must the first identification tag be placed on a deceased? -^ CORRECT ANSWER

>>> Prior to removal from the place of death

Must cemeteries place an identifying marker on outer burial containers, and if so what is

required?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Yes, it must be a permanent identifying mark, listing the

name of decedent and the date of death.

Prior to final disposition, the ________ must place an identification tag on the body -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> Licensee in charge

In regards to trust funds, owners, directors and officers are held: -^ CORRECT ANSWER

>>> Jointly and severally liable for any deficiency in any trust fund required by this chapter (497)

A license issued to those who have applied for a permanent license by endorsement, and

approved to take the Florida Law and Rules Examination. It is good for 60 days. - CORRECT

ANSWER >>> Temporary License

A license issued to those who have already applied for a permanent license, completed a Florida internship, and been approved to take the Florida Laws and Rules examination. It is good for 6

months. -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Provisional License

When must the Report of Cases Embalmed or Bodies Handled be completed? - CORRECT

ANSWER >>> Each month. It is due by the 20th of the subsequent month, and is available for

inspection.

Funeral directors must renew their license____ -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Biennially Funeral

directors over the age of ____ do not need to complete the continuing education requirement,

provided they are not the funeral director in charge of an establishment -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> 75

A Funeral establishment must be at a specific address and the interior must have at

least_______contiguous square feet - CORRECT ANSWER >>> 1250

When a visitation is in progress at a visitation chapel, the funeral director must be: -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> Physically present in the chapel

A visitation chapel must be: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> At least 500 sq feet and not more than

700 sq feet in size. A funeral establishment may not be collocated with another funeral establishment or with a

direct disposal establishment unless: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> They were collocated prior to

October 1, 1993. Is it legal for your funeral home to give an honorarium to a nurse at a hospital if, after a death

occurs, she/he asks the family to use your funeral establishment? Why or why not? - CORRECT

ANSWER >>> No, this could be at-need solicitation, which is illegal.

If a central embalming facility is located within a funeral establishment, does it need to acquire

a central embalming facility license?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> No - the Centralized

Embalming Facility license is for those prep rooms that are independent of a funeral establishment.

Bodies may not be stored for over 24 hours unless: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> They are

embalmed or stored in refrigeration under 40 degrees

When transporting or storing human remains, the body must be: -^ CORRECT ANSWER

>>> Completely covered at all times

If a crime is suspected, a body can not be moved or embalmed without permission of the: -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> Medical Examiner

Direct disposers may only perform the following functions: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Make

removals and refrigerate dead body

  • Secure information for death certificate
  • Obtain necessary permits and place obituaries
  • Transport to DD establishment for direct disposition
  • Contract with a removal service to make removals

A direct disposer may NOT: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Sell, conduct, or arrange burials, funeral

services, memorial services, visitations or viewings, or pretend to be funeral directors.

May a direct disposer conduct a direct burial?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> No

How many continuing education hours are needed by a direct disposer? - CORRECT ANSWER

>>> 6 hours of continuing education

There shall be either a refrigeration room for the storage of dead human bodies, or written arrangements for the refrigeration and storage of dead human bodies at a facility within ____

miles of the funeral establishment. - CORRECT ANSWER >>> 75

A proposed cemetery must be at least ____ contiguous acres - CORRECT ANSWER >>> 30

The applicant for a proposed cemetery must have a net worth of $_________, which must

continually be maintained. - CORRECT ANSWER >>> $50,

What is the minimum amount which must be deposited into a Care and Maintenance trust fund

for a new cemetery?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> $50,000 (This amount is separate from the

Net worth which is required.) Considering the required net worth of the applicant and the funds required in the Care and Maintenance Trust Fund, plus the $5000 application fee, you need at least $_________ and

_____ acres of land to start a cemetery in Florida - CORRECT ANSWER >>> $105,000 and 30

acres.

What 2 maps are needed to start a new cemetery?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Map of the

cemetery, and a map of the local area around the proposed cemetery

The license renewal and fees for a cemetery are due: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> Each year on

or before December 31

When the burial rights are sold for a grave space, the cemetery must deposit a portion of the

money into the Care and Maintenance Trust Fund. The amount is: -^ CORRECT ANSWER

>>> 10 percent and no less than $25 per grave space

The Care and Maintenance trust deposits must be made within: -^ CORRECT ANSWER^ >>>^30

days from the end of the calendar month in which received If a new owner is buying a cemetery, the care and maintenance trust fund must have an amount

equal to the higher of: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> $50,000 or $25 for each previously sold

grave space

If a cemetery is building a new mausoleum, they must begin construction either: - CORRECT

ANSWER >>> Within 4 years of the date of the first sale of a space OR when 50% of the spaces

have been sold.

The construction of a mausoleum must be completed within: - CORRECT ANSWER >>> 5

years of the date of sale of the first space in the mausoleum

What is the minimum size of a grave space?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> 42 inches wide by 96

inches long

What is the minimum amount of top soil that must cover an outer burial container? -

CORRECT ANSWER >>> 12 inches of top soil

When is a cemetery considered to be abandoned? - CORRECT ANSWER >>> After 6 months

with no reasonable maintenance
